GE to Sell Mortgage Assets to Santander
Wall Street Journal
By PAUL GLADER And BOB SECHLER Spain's Grupo Santander agreed to purchase a $2 billion mortgage portfolio of Mexican real-estate assets from General Electric Co.'s finance division for $162 million plus the assumption of debt. ...

Gasoline Prices Hit $3 a Gallon Nationwide
Reuters
By Gas 2.0 at Gas 2.0 by Christopher DeMorro Today, the national average price for a gallon of gas has risen to over $3 a gallon for the first time since October, 2008, when it felt like the bottom had just dropped out of the American economy. ...
